In the Georgian period in the Georgian period, sliding sash windows were invented. They have two sashes that slide up and down along a vertical groove in the frame. The sashes allow heat let out naturally. They are an ideal choice for listed properties as well as difficult spaces. It's also possible to look into a spring sash, which replaces a weighted sash with a spring. Spring sash windows have a smoother opening and reduce the bulk of the frame. Aluminium windows are more durable than timber windows and require less maintenance. This is particularly crucial for windows that are going to be exposed to harsher weather conditions. Another aspect to consider is the thermal performance of the window. A lot of windows feature a thermal barrier made of polyamide that prevents cold air from getting into the space.
